Re: Galeon problem solved!



On Tue, 2001-09-11 at 14:18, Richard Cobbe wrote:
> 1) Galeon tends to be quite sensitive to your Mozilla install.  Upgrading
>    mozilla will likely break Galeon, requiring at the least a rebuild.

Correction - Galeon is extremely sensitive to Mozilla versions.  Mozilla
change the embed API frequently which breaks the source, and two C++
modules which link (galeon -> mozilla) must both be compiled wit the
same C++ compiler which complicates matters more.
